How Dexscreener Works: Core Concepts

At the core, dexscreener is a specialized indexer and UI layer for decentralized exchange data. It listens to blockchain events, aggregates trades, pools, and liquidity changes, then displays them in an accessible format. You can consider it a live map of DEX flow – buys, sells, large transfers, rug checks, fresh listings – all surfaced in near real time.

Technically the tool uses RPC endpoints and on-chain logs to feed a pipeline. That pipeline normalizes varied DEX protocols into a single view so you don’t have to chase 10 different interfaces. For traders this saves time and reduces the chance of missing a fast move. For research it gives a consistent dataset to analyze patterns.

Why use a dex scanner rather than raw node queries or exchange GUIs? Because it abstracts complexity, filters noise, and highlights signals. The algorithmic filters can be tuned to show only tokens with certain liquidity, volume spikes, or transfer patterns. You decide what matters – the scanner does the heavy lifting.

Using the Dex Scanner Interface and Tools

When you open the interface, the initial dashboard often lists top movers, newly listed pairs, and suspicious behaviour. Pay attention to the columns – price impact, age of the pool, and liquidity are quick heuristics. A token with tiny liquidity and a volume spike can mean explosive volatility or an exit opportunity for creators.

Practical workflow: start with the watchlist, add pairs you track, then create alerts. Use charting widgets to zoom into the first minutes after listing – that window frequently reveals the pattern of buys and sells. I personally keep a short list of filters that isolate tokens with a minimum liquidity threshold and a rapid rise in buy-side volume; this weeds out tokens that are just being pumped for a few trades.

There are keyboard shortcuts and export options. Experienced users export events for local backtesting. If you write strategies, integrate the scanner output into your scripts. The UI alone is powerful, but pairing it with a bit of automation turns a good scanner into a systematic tool.

Data Feeds, Alerts, and Integration

Data quality matters. Dex scanners pull from multiple RPC nodes and sometimes mirror block explorers to reconcile events. Discrepancies can occur when a chain has reorgs or nodes lag. The platform typically flags uncertain events, but a savvy user also checks raw transaction hashes in a block explorer when in doubt.

Alerts are a major feature. Set price thresholds, volume spikes, or new pool alerts. Alerts can trigger push notifications, webhook calls, or on-screen banners. For algorithmic traders, webhooks are the bridge to execution – your bot listens for an alert, then executes a pre-defined order template on the target DEX.

Integration points are varied. Some scanners offer API endpoints, while others provide CSV exports and embeddable widgets. If you aim to build a multi-source strategy, use the API for continuous polling and combine results with on-chain sentiment signals. Latency still matters – opt for endpoints with SLA assurances if you rely on sub-second decision windows.

dexscreener review – pros and cons

Here’s an honest dexscreener review from someone who has used multiple scanners. The pros: fast discovery of new tokens, clear liquidity visibility, and useful filters that reduce noise. The UI often feels tuned for traders who want immediacy – charts, depth, and transaction traces are all within two clicks.

Cons include occasional false positives on volume due to wash trades, UI clutter when you track many pairs, and the learning curve for customizing alerts effectively. Another practical drawback is that no scanner is perfect at spotting sophisticated rugs that use delayed or off-chain mechanisms. Use the tool as part of a broader due diligence checklist.

When I evaluate scanners, I look for three critical items – data freshness, filter flexibility, and exportability. Dex scanners that hit those marks provide the best utility in fast markets. Still, combine insights with manual checks: read contract code, review ownership, and check team presence when possible.

One practical note: some tokens are deliberately obfuscated by creators to avoid early detection. That makes the role of the scanner more important – spotting distribution of tokens across wallets, or repeated small sells, can hint at potential rug behavior. Use pattern recognition on the scanner rather than trusting any single metric.

Security remains a constant theme. Never connect a reading-only wallet to a trading bot that can sign transactions without careful vetting. Tools that offer connect functionality should be audited and have clear permission scopes. It’s a good practice to use separate wallets for exploration and for active trading.

About community feedback – frequent users contribute filters, template alerts, and public watchlists. These shared artifacts often accelerate the learning curve. But beware of crowd-sourced lists that can be manipulated; do your own validation.

Let’s touch on the analytics layer. Some dexscreener features run simple on-chain analytics – liquidity depth over time, buy-sell imbalance, rug risk scores. Combine those metrics with chart patterns like wick length, candle clustering, and time-weighted volume for a fuller picture. Good scanners surface these metrics, but you need to interpret them in context.

One advanced approach is to correlate scanner signals with external data – social mentions, developer activity, or token approvals. Cross-verification reduces false positives. A rapid spike in token approvals plus a sudden surge in buys often indicates automated laundering of liquidity or coordinated activity; treat such signals cautiously.
